Nasarawa Assembly member visits hospital, gifts cash to patients

A member representing Lafia Central Constituency at the Nasarawa State House of Assembly, Solomon Akwashiki, on Tuesday visited Dalhatu Araf Specialist Hospital, Lafia, to offer assistance to the patients.

Mr Akwashiki, Minority Whip and Chairman, Committee on Public Accounts, distributed cash to the patients during the visit.

He said that the purpose of the visit was to identify with the patients and join them in prayers for quick recovery.

He said, “I am here to identify with the sick ones with what God has blessed me with. What I have given them will help them in getting medication or food to eat. What I am doing is to trying to improve their health and standard of living.’’

Mr Akwashiki prayed to God to grant them quick recovery and sound health.

He assured the people in his constituency of continued commitment to initiating policies and programmes with direct bearing on their lives.

He stated, “I have done so much in the area of education, road, electricity, water, employment, health, empowerment among others

By God’s grace, I will continue to do more to bring speedy development to Lafia Central constituency and humanity at large.’’

The lawmaker visited Paediatric Surgical, female medical and male medical wards of the hospital.

The patients appreciated the lawmaker for the gesture and prayed to God to bless him.
